Key Features to Look for in a Finance App
When selecting a personal finance management app, some key features should be top of mind to ensure it meets your needs. First and foremost, ease of use and a user-friendly interface are crucial. An app that is difficult to navigate can lead to frustration and an unwillingness to engage with your finances regularly.
Security should also be a top priority. Look for apps that offer encryption, two-factor authentication, and reputable data privacy policies. As financial data is sensitive, ensuring it is protected is paramount.
Furthermore, comprehensive tracking and analysis capabilities can offer invaluable insights. The ability to categorize expenses, visualize spending through charts and graphs, and receive regular reports can help in making data-driven financial decisions.
Top-Rated Apps for Personal Finance Management in 2025
In the ever-growing app marketplace, several standout options have emerged in 2025. Here’s a look at some of the top-rated apps for personal finance management:
-
Mint: Known for its all-in-one budgeting capabilities and user-friendly interface, Mint allows users to track expenses, set goals, and stay on top of bills.
-
YNAB (You Need A Budget): Focused on proactive budgeting, YNAB helps users gain total control over their money and plan for both short-term and long-term financial goals.
-
PocketGuard: This app simplifies budgeting by showing users how much disposable income they have after paying bills and necessities, perfect for those new to financial management.
-
Personal Capital: Offering a unique blend of budgeting tools and investment tracking, Personal Capital is ideal for those interested in growing their wealth.

Comparison of Free vs Paid Finance Apps
When deciding between free and paid finance apps, it’s important to weigh the advantages and limitations of each. Free apps often provide basic budgeting and tracking features, making them accessible to a wide audience. However, they may include ads or limit access to premium features.
Paid apps, on the other hand, tend to offer more robust feature sets, such as enhanced reporting and personalized support. They are often ad-free and may offer advanced tools, like investment analysis or debt reduction planners, which are absent from their free counterparts.
Ultimately, the choice between free and paid apps comes down to your specific needs and how much you are willing to invest in financial management. Evaluate what features are must-have versus nice-to-have, and consider trial versions of paid apps to determine if they justify the cost.

Common Concerns About Finance Apps and Their Solutions
Many users have concerns about adopting financial apps, primarily revolving around data security, privacy, and accuracy of information. Fortunately, most top finance apps prioritize security with industry-standard encryption and secure connections.
Privacy-related hesitations are valid, but rest assured, trusted apps offer robust privacy policies detailing how your data is used and stored. Always review these policies to understand the app’s commitments to your data.
Questions about accuracy often arise, particularly when an app connects to external bank accounts and investments. While most apps use reliable API connections to retrieve data, occasional discrepancies can happen. Regularly reviewing and adjusting your app’s settings for accuracy can help maintain data integrity.

FAQ Section
What is the best app for beginners looking to manage their finances?
Mint is often recommended for beginners due to its user-friendly interface and comprehensive features that cover budgeting, tracking expenses, and financial goal setting.
Are paid finance apps worth the investment?
Paid apps can offer enhanced features like advanced analytics and ad-free experiences that justify the cost, especially for users with specific financial goals.
How do finance apps help with budget tracking?
Finance apps help by categorizing expenses, setting up budgets, and providing visual insights through graphs and reports, making it easier to understand spending habits.
Can finance apps be used for both personal and business expenses?
Yes, some apps allow users to manage both personal and business finances by creating separate accounts or using different tracking features.
Are there finance apps designed specifically for families?
Many apps offer features like shared accounts or family budgeting tools, allowing multiple users to track and manage finances collaboratively.
How can I ensure my financial data is safe on these apps?
Ensure the app uses encryption, read their privacy policy, and use strong, unique passwords along with two-factor authentication for additional security.
Do personal finance apps work offline?
Some apps offer offline functionality, allowing users to enter transactions without an internet connection, with data syncing once they reconnect.
